The new season will focus on the titular brothers,Lyle and Erik Menendez, and unfurl the story of how the duo fatally shot their parents in 1989.The brothers cited their own motives for committing the crime. However, prosecutors put forth their theories during the high-profile trial. More is revealed via Netflix’s official summary, which is included below:
Monsters: The Lyle and Erik Menendez Storyfollows Lyle and Erik Menendez, two brothers who fatally shot their parents in their Beverly Hills home in 1989. During their trials, the brothers cited years of abuse as the reason for murdering their parents. However, prosecutors argued that their motive was to get their hands on the family fortune.

While the prosecution argued they were seeking to inherit their family fortune, the brothers claimed — and remain adamant to this day, as they serve life sentences without the possibility of parole — that their actions stemmed out of fear from a lifetime of physical, emotional, and sexual abuse at the hands of their parents.Monsters: The Lyle and Erik Menendez Storydives into the historic case that took the world by storm, paved the way for audiences’ modern-day fascination with true crime, and in return asks those audiences: Who are the real monsters?
The cast ofMonsterseason 2 includes newcomers Nicholas Alexander Chavez and Cooper Kochas the brothers Lyle and Erik, while Javier Bardem and Chloë Sevigny play their parents, Jose and Kitty. Other high-profile actors on the Netflix show are Nathan Lane as an investigative journalist who covers the trial forVanity Fair,and Ari Graynor in the role of Erik’s lead defense counsel.

The true crime anthology is executive produced by Murphy and his frequent writing partner Ian Brennan. The first season ofMonster, with its focus on Dahmer, was divisive among critics and audiences.It sparked a backlash from some of the families of Dahmer’s victims, with arguments that the series glorified the infamous killereven in its attempts to condemn him. It became a big hit for Netflix nonetheless, with the second installment touching on a similarly well-known murder case.
